Seaspeed Story (1970)

A study of the development of British Rail's hovercraft services in the Solent and across the Channel, using SRN6, HM2 and SRN4 air-cushion vehicles.

Director: R.K. Neilson-Baxter
Genre: Documentary
Runtime: 28 min
